I have shared my stack "Python Samples with Tkinter" in the Programming category.

This stack demonstrates some use of the Python tool called from Revolution with two examples of the Tkinter GUI toolkit. Set the folder for Python tool to the correct one (e.g. under MacOSX: /usr/bin or /usr/local/bin)... Notice that this version display the Python window in modal mod, so you cannot edit stacks before you quit the Python thread. It works fine under MacOSX which has a standard Python tool, others not tested.

If you are curious, open the stacks and execute in the msg box:

  put the uPythonSource of button "Test I with python Tkinter GUI"
or
  put the uPythonSource of button "Test II with python Tkinter GUI"

to read the Python source code (just 36 lines, respectively 25 lines).
